The Battle for the Physical Soul: The Evolving Legal Landscape of Celebrity Estates

The recent legal clash between Mitch Winehouse and former associates of the late Amy Winehouse highlights a growing tension in the modern era: who truly owns the remnants of a legend? When personal belongings—clothes, bags, handwritten notes—transition from private keepsakes to million-dollar assets, the line between a “gift” and “estate property” becomes a legal battlefield.

View this post on Instagram about Amy Winehouse, Winehouse
From Instagram — related to Amy Winehouse, Winehouse

As the market for celebrity memorabilia continues to skyrocket, we are seeing a shift in how courts handle the intersection of friendship, inheritance, and commercial profit. This isn’t just about a few dresses; it’s about the control of a cultural legacy.

Did you know? The market for “pop culture memorabilia” has seen an exponential rise, with some items appreciating by over 1,000% within a decade of the artist’s passing, transforming closets into goldmines.

From Closets to Courtrooms: The Rise of ‘Provenance Disputes’

For decades, the sale of celebrity items was largely unregulated, often handled by executors or close confidants. However, as seen in the London High Court’s ruling regarding the $1.4 million auction of Winehouse’s belongings, the judiciary is now placing a higher premium on provenance and the intent of the original gift.

The trend is moving toward a stricter interpretation of ownership. If an item was gifted during the celebrity’s lifetime, it generally ceases to be part of the estate. This creates a complex dynamic where family members may feel a moral right to the items, while friends hold the legal title.

We are likely to spot more “legacy audits” in the future, where estates proactively catalog items to prevent clandestine auctions. High-profile cases, such as those involving the estates of legendary musicians and actors, show that clarity in will-writing is no longer optional—it is a necessity to avoid decade-long litigation.

The Ethics of the ‘Profit vs. Passion’ Divide

A recurring theme in these disputes is the destination of the funds. In the Winehouse case, a significant portion of the proceeds went to a charitable foundation. This reflects a broader trend: the “Philanthropic Pivot.”

Future celebrity auctions will likely move away from private profit and toward structured trusts. By directing funds to foundations, sellers can mitigate “bad press” and potentially reduce the likelihood of heirs suing for “unjust enrichment.”

Frequently Asked Questions

Can a family member sue to recover a gift given by a deceased person?
Generally, no. If the item was a bona fide gift given during the person’s lifetime, it belongs to the recipient. However, if the gift was conditional or the transfer of ownership wasn’t completed, the estate may have a claim.

What is ‘provenance’ in the context of collectibles?
Provenance is the documented history of an item’s ownership. It acts as a pedigree, proving the item is authentic and was acquired legally.

How do charitable foundations benefit from celebrity auctions?
Foundations often provide a neutral ground for the sale of assets, ensuring that the celebrity’s legacy is associated with a cause rather than a family feud, while providing tax benefits to the estate.

Milan’s Mateta Deal Collapses: A Sign of Increasing Scrutiny in Football Transfers?

The potential transfer of French striker Georges-Kevin Nketa (referred to as Mateta in the article) from Crystal Palace to AC Milan has fallen through after further medical examinations revealed concerns about a previous meniscus injury. This isn’t just a setback for Milan; it’s a potential bellwether for a growing trend in football: increasingly rigorous medical due diligence and a heightened risk aversion when it comes to player acquisitions.

The Rising Cost of Risk in Player Transfers

For years, football clubs operated with a degree of accepted risk in transfers. A player’s medical history was reviewed, but the pressure to secure talent often outweighed cautiousness. Now, with transfer fees skyrocketing and Financial Fair Play regulations tightening, clubs are far less willing to gamble on players with pre-existing conditions. The Mateta case, stemming from a 2019 injury while at Mainz, highlights this shift. Milan’s decision to withdraw from the deal, despite an agreement in principle, demonstrates a commitment to long-term financial stability over immediate squad reinforcement.

This trend is fueled by several factors. The Premier League, for example, has seen a dramatic increase in spending on sports science and medical staff. Clubs are investing heavily in data analytics to predict injury risk and optimize player performance. According to a 2023 report by Deloitte, Premier League clubs spent over £500 million on wages for medical and sports science staff.

Beyond the Meniscus: The Broader Implications of Medical Scrutiny

The focus isn’t solely on catastrophic injuries. Clubs are now meticulously examining players for conditions that might not immediately impact performance but could lead to future problems and costly surgeries. This includes assessing the long-term effects of previous concussions, subtle ligament damage, and even predispositions to certain types of muscle strains. The Mateta situation, where the concern revolves around potential future surgery, is a prime example.

This increased scrutiny is also impacting the role of agents. Agents are now under pressure to provide more comprehensive medical documentation upfront, and transparency is becoming paramount. Any attempt to conceal information could jeopardize a deal and damage the agent’s reputation.

The Impact on Smaller Clubs and Loan Deals

While top-tier clubs like Milan can afford to conduct extensive medical investigations, smaller clubs may lack the resources. This creates an uneven playing field. However, even smaller clubs are becoming more aware of the risks and are increasingly relying on independent medical assessments.

Loan deals are also being affected. Clubs are less likely to take on players with questionable medical histories on loan, as they have limited financial incentive to invest in their rehabilitation. This could lead to a decrease in loan opportunities for players recovering from injuries.

The Role of Technology in Predictive Injury Analysis

Technology is playing an increasingly important role in predicting injury risk. Companies like STATSports and Catapult Sports provide wearable technology that tracks player movements, heart rate, and other physiological data. This data can be analyzed to identify patterns that might indicate an increased risk of injury. Machine learning algorithms are also being used to predict injuries based on a variety of factors, including player age, training load, and medical history.

        The Italian music scene mourns the loss of Livio Macchia, a key figure in the band I Camaleonti. This group, which started in 1963, defined the Italian Beat scene. Macchia, with his distinctive hairstyle and handlebar mustache, was a recognizable figure. Their story began with youthful dreams and shared passions, eventually leading to an enduring 60-year career.
    </p>
</div>
<div class="content  " id="m17831-17830-17832">
    <p class="chapter-paragraph">
        They began playing in clubs, captivating audiences with their unique blend of music. Their breakthrough came when Miki Del Prete, a collaborator of Adriano Celentano, took notice. One of their early hits, "Sha... la la la la," gained significant popularity. Despite the song not officially existing initially, it was eventually recorded and sold hundreds of thousands of copies.
    </p>
</div>
<div class="content  " id="m17836-17835-17837">
    <h2 class="native-summary-content paragraph-summary title-art is-small--bre-c-h " spellcheck="true" id="m17893-17892-17894">I Camaleonti: Pioneers of Italian Beat</h2>
    <p class="chapter-paragraph">
        I Camaleonti became synonymous with the Italian Beat, covering famous songs in Italian. They experimented with genres, giving them the name "Chameleons" (Camaleonti). In 1966, they released their first album, *The Best Records in the World*, followed by singles. They covered hits from artists such as Bob Dylan, The Beatles, The Rolling Stones, and Herman's Hermits. The band's most successful year was 1968, reaching the top of the charts with "L'ora dell'amore" (Homburg by Procol Harum). This success continued with "Io per lei" (a cover of Frankie Valli's "To Give") and "Applausi." In 1970, they achieved further success at the Sanremo Festival with "Eternità" with Ornella Vanoni.
    </p>

The center-left does not pass the goal it had set for itself, and the data on citizenship stops at 9 million voters. More voters in ZTLs and in the “strong” areas of the Democratic Party, fewer in those of the 5 Stars.

Despite all the formulas and distinctions that animated the pre-vote debate — “I take two yeses and three noes”, “I only take two ballots, thank you…” — in the end, turnout was practically the same for all questions. As well as being far from the quorum: at 30.6% (Italy data, it is lower with the vote of Italians abroad, at 29.9). And, with the significant exception of the citizenship ballot, the results are also homogeneous, with the yes over 87%.

14.1 million voters went to the polls. Not enough to reach the quorum target. But it was another the bar set by the leaders of the center-left, reiterated in unison in yesterday’s declarations: exceeding the 12.3 million votes that in 2022, in the political elections, sent Giorgia Meloni to Palazzo Chigi (the data concerns the national territory and with this, therefore, the comparison is made here: it would rise to 12.6 with abroad). Comfortable bar, certainly, moreover, it was the promoters themselves who set it. But in the end, at least that one, was it overcome?

The Threshold Touched Upon

“The final data risks not even giving satisfaction to this threshold,” notes Lorenzo Pregliasco, director of YouTrend. Take the questions on work, where the Democratic Party, M5S and Avs were united for yes. Here they stopped at 12.250 million, considering the question that collected the most, on layoffs (Italy data), considering also the vote of Italians abroad we are just above 13 million. That is, they have touched on those famous 12.3, there was no clear overtaking. Only, in fact, considering the foreign polling stations, it exceeds, slightly, the 12.6 million of Meloni in 2022. “And on citizenship we are very far away“. The number of those who responded affirmatively to the proposal to halve the time for the request — supported by the Democratic Party, Avs, Action, Iv and +Europa — stops around 9 million. Evidentemente something didn’t work: “On the one hand there was a politicization of the questions, beyond the merits, and this distanced a part that is not militant. Pushing on the identity pedal, on the other hand, it was not enough to mobilize the opposition electorate in force,” comments Pregliasco.

PD vs 5 Stars

Tuscany and Emilia-Romagna, strongholds of the Democratic Party, are the two regions where turnout is highest (39.1 and 38.1 respectively). In the South, in historical basins of the 5 Stars, percentages are recorded below the national average (23.1 in Sicily, 27.7 in Sardinia, a little better in Campania, 29.9). It is one of the first data discussed in the post-vote debate: a sign that should worry the 5 Star Movement? “A lower participation was expected in the South, it is a trend already recorded and in addition Article 18 and citizenship speak less to that electorate,” Pregliasco anticipates. But from the analysis of YouTrend a data emerges: “In the strongholds of the Democratic Party and Avs — that is, in the municipalities where these parties in 2022 and in the last European elections have cashed in better results than their national average — turnout was above 36%. In the strongholds of the 5 Stars below 28%”.

ZTLs and Peripheries

There is another piece of data, the distribution of votes in cities. In the historic centers of the big cities, the yes to citizenship were higher: 80% in the Milan 1 district (against 74% of the city average and above the national result) and in Turin 1 exceeds 81%, a result 5 points higher than layoffs. Here they have adhered more to citizenship than to work: from San Salvario to Mirafiori, in the popular areas, instead, the most voted were the questions on contracts. “Situation, that of ZTLs, which, as often happens, is not representative of the trends of the country”.

The Big Cities

Driving turnout are above all the big cities. For Salvatore Vassallo, professor of Political Science and director of the Istituto Cattaneo, one of the most evident data “is the difference between large and small centers“: “In the cities over 350 thousand inhabitants, on average, 7 percentage points of turnout were recorded more than the average of all the municipalities. The difference rises to 10 points if the comparison is made with the centers under 15 thousand inhabitants. This gap had never been recorded,” comments the political scientist. And not only “because in the large centers the voters of the broad field voted above all, and among these above all the voters of the Democratic Party”, think of Florence at 46.9 and Bologna at 47.7 (but then there are also Turin, 41.4%, Genoa, 40.4, Milan, 36.8, and Rome, 36.2). “Perhaps — he continues — there is something else, the citizens closest to the “structured networks” of the trade union, of the parties, have been mobilized”. On turnout, however, Vassallo does not speak of a collapse: “If we compare it with the referendums after 1999 — a key year that certified that a quota of strategic abstentionism is enough to block a consultation — we are substantially in line”.

Center-Right at the Polls

Be careful, however, to read these data with an excessively “parliamentary” tone, where the yeses are the opposition and the abstainers the majority. “In reality, it’s all more nuanced than that,” explains Antonio Noto, who directs Noto Sondaggi. The surveys on the vote have shown “that a fifth of the center-right electorate went to vote, while a third of the center-left electorate did not go to the polls. Even a part of the Democratic Party electorate did not go”.

The North versus South difference is marked. “Yes, the North voted more, but beyond Veneto, we find among the regions where turnout is highest Piedmont and Liguria, governed by the center-right”. According to Noto, an “down effect” for the late abstainers may have influenced the final result: “The data of Monday, of how many voted from 7 to 15, is lower in comparison with the data of the previous Mondays. Probably the result of Sunday evening has discouraged many from going to the polls“.

It should be noted that for the first time, turnout was higher among women than among men (with the only exception of Taranto, noted YouTrend). Only a year ago in 91 provinces the men had participated more.
